
Ministry of Antiquities
The Ministry of Antiquities is a government body in Egypt responsible for safeguarding the country’s rich archaeological heritage. Established in 2016, it oversees the preservation, restoration, and management of ancient sites, artifacts, and museums. The Ministry works to protect Egypt’s historical treasures from damage or theft and promotes archaeological research and tourism. It plays a crucial role in the exploration and study of ancient Egyptian civilization, ensuring that important cultural heritage is both protected and accessible to the public, highlighting the significance of Egypt’s historical contributions to global history.
